Artist History
We started out in 1991 recording a demo-tape under the name of Mehdi. In 1992 we formed the rockband Rubber Revolver and played live in Stockholm until 1996. During the last year we've been writing and producing new songs under the name of Tuba, leaving the guitarbased rocksound of Rubber Revolver behind, introducing a new touch of pop. |

Press Reviews
"Trance-inducing, soothing Pop songs with bits of Brit-Pop spliced into the mix. Songs move slowly, with slumberous backing beats and vocals that fly as high as Thom Yorke's -- without all the anguish. The verdict? Tuba are good at making really good songs." - Howard M, Listen.com. "Blissful, optimistic pop songs feature lush keyboard textures, one-note melodies, and dreamy guitar jangling, while droning Space Rock grooves shake and rattle with rolling breakbeats." - Noah E, Listen.com |
